// How To Use //


1. Wet the sponge and squeeze out any excess water.

2. Apply product.



3. Stipple: Bounce the sponge onto the skin while applying light pressure onto the surface of your skin.

4. Mistakes happen all the time, when they do use a dry beauty blender to buff away streaks.

Application: 5/5 
It is a little time consuming running it under tap water, but it's definitely worth it. I've never seen a smoother application. With brushes it takes me about 5 minutes to even the product out. (Remember to press it into the skin and bounce it. Over time I discovered that it helps to roll it into your skin to conceal blemishes to the extreme.)

Finish: 5/5
I love the dewy finish the blender leaves on my face. There are no streaks whatsoever which is something I absolutely love.

Price: 4/5
This product retails for approximately $19.95. Overall it is a bit pricey, but it's definitely worth it. It's nothing different compared to your average foundation blush.
